Also, there are 10% cancellation penalties on some tours if you wait to cancel until you are onboard and only a few days away from the tour.  Some tours that involve aircraft, like helicopter tours, require many more days if you want to cancel and expect to get your money back.   Yes, it is a gamble that the tour you booked online may be sold out when you board the ship.  If you cancel, to get your cash back and re-book onboard, you will go to the bottom of the waiting list, and it may never clear.

Prepaid refunds are "refundable OBC" and used after the "non-refundable OBC" is depleted.

 

If your "land tours" are part of an Alaska cruisetour, you can only book land portion events online and NOT after you board the ship (I learned that this past week when I wanted to add an excursion in Denali).  If you mean shore excursions that occur during a cruise, you can book both online and while onboard the ship.
